Do you know about POS/Billing Software?
In the context of technology and business, POS
stands for Point of Sale. A Point of Sale system
is a computerized system used to manage sales
transactions in a retail or restaurant business.
It typically consists of hardware such as a
computer or tablet, a cash drawer, a barcode
scanner, a receipt printer, and software that
manages the inventory and sales data. When a
customer purchases, the POS system calculates the
total amount due, processes the payment, and
updates the inventory in real time. This allows
businesses to keep track of their sales,
inventory, and revenue more e?ciently and also
provides
2
  • valuable data that can be used to analyze sales
    patterns and make informed business
  • decisions.
  • POS systems are commonly used in a wide range of
    businesses, from small retail stores and
    restaurants to large-scale chain stores and
    supermarkets. They have become an essential tool
    for modern businesses to operate e?ciently and
    effectively.
  • A POS (Point Of Sale) System Can Increase
    Productivity In Retail And Restaurant Businesses
    In Several Ways
  • Streamlined Transactions A POS system can
    streamline the transaction process by automating
    tasks such as calculating prices, applying
    discounts, and processing payments. This can
    reduce the time required to complete
    transactions, resulting in faster and more
    e?cient service.
  • Inventory Management POS systems can help
    retailers and restaurants track their inventory
    levels, monitor product sales, and identify
    trends in customer purchasing behavior. This
    information can be used to optimize inventory
    levels, reduce waste, and ensure that popular
    products are always in stock.
  • Reporting and Analytics POS systems can
    generate detailed reports on sales, inventory
    levels, and customer behavior. This information
    can be used to identify areas for improvement,
    such as identifying slow-moving products or
    optimizing menu items in a restaurant.
  • Employee Management POS systems can be used to
    manage employee schedules, track employee
    performance, and monitor labor costs. This can
    help businesses optimize their sta?ng levels and
    ensure that employees are performing e?ciently.

5. Customer Management POS systems can store
customer data such as contact information,
purchase history, and loyalty program status.
This information can be used to personalize
customer interactions, such as offering discounts
or special promotions to loyal customers.
Here are some key features of a POS (Point of
Sale) system
  • Transaction Processing A POS system should be
    able to process transactions
  • quickly and accurately, including accepting
    multiple payment types such as cash, credit
    cards, and mobile payments.
  • Inventory Management A POS system should have
    the ability to track inventory levels, monitor
    sales trends, and generate reports on stock
    levels, allowing businesses to optimize their
    inventory and reduce waste.
  • Reporting and Analytics A POS system should be
    able to generate reports on sales, inventory
    levels, employee performance, and customer
    behavior.
  • Employee Management A POS system should allow
    businesses to manage employee schedules, track
    employee performance, and monitor labor costs.
  • Customer Management A POS system should be able
    to store customer data, such as contact
    information and purchase history, and provide
    features such as loyalty programs and targeted
    promotions.
  • Integration with Other Systems A POS system
    should be able to integrate with other systems
    such as accounting software, e-commerce
    platforms, and inventory management systems.

4
  • Security A POS system should have security
    features such as encryption, user
  • authentication, and access controls to protect
    sensitive data.
  • User-Friendly Interface A POS system should
    have an intuitive interface that is easy for
    employees to use and navigate, reducing the
    potential for errors and increasing
    productivity.
  • Benefits of POS Systems
  • There are many bene?ts of using a POS (Point of
    Sale) system in retail and restaurant
    businesses, including
  • Increased E?ciency A POS system can streamline
    business operations, reducing the time and
    effort required to complete tasks such as
    inventory management, transaction processing,
    and reporting.
  • Improved Accuracy A POS system can reduce the
    risk of human error in tasks such as pricing and
    inventory management, ensuring that data is
    accurate and up-to-date.
  • Enhanced Customer Experience A POS system can
    improve the customer experience by providing
    fast and e?cient service, personalized
    promotions, and loyalty programs.
  • Better Business Insights A POS system can
    provide valuable data insights into sales
    trends, inventory levels, employee performance,
    and customer behavior, allowing businesses to
    make informed decisions and optimize their
    operations.
  • Increased Sales A POS system can help
    businesses increase sales by providing features
    such as upselling suggestions, targeted
    promotions, and loyalty programs.

5
  • Cost Savings A POS system can help businesses
    reduce costs by optimizing
  • inventory levels, reducing waste, and identifying
    opportunities to improve e?ciency.
  • Improved Security A POS system can enhance
    security by providing features such as user
    authentication, access controls, and encryption,
    protecting sensitive data and reducing the risk
    of fraud.
